Vibrational circular dichroism (VCD) spectra are reported for d(GC)(20). d(GC)(20) and d(ATGCATGCAT). d(ATGCATGCAT) in D2O without Mn2+ and in the presence of 0.64 and 0.50 [Mn]/[P] concentration ratios, respectively. Changes in the VCD spectra are compared with the changes of the corresponding infrared absorption bands and interpreted in terms of structural changes in the oligonucleotides. Based on these examples, it appears that VCD provides better definition of structural modification as a result of complexation with Mn2+ ions than infrared absorption. (C) 1999 Elsevier Science B.V.
